"Shedding light on a range of price adjustment mechanisms and price display technologies, this incisive book offers a clear overview of the retail price setting and alteration process. Based on a detailed study of a century of pricing practices in the US retail sector, it explores the anthropology and sociology of valuation practices by concentrating on the way prices are fabricated. Fixing Prices examines the relationship between everyday price display innovations, such as price tag devices, and wider market changes, including the introduction of price regulations about price display and item pricing. Investigating the historical development of price display, the book demonstrates the extent to which the materiality of prices contributes to the creation of different price-based valuation tactics. Offering a historical perspective on pricing in the US retail sector, this unique book will prove invaluable to students of marketing, economic sociology, and industrial economics. It will also benefit industry professionals wanting to expand their knowledge surrounding pricing procedures"--

Ne vous êtes-vous jamais demandé, dans un avion ou dans un train, pourquoi votre voisin avait payé moins cher que vous ? Ce livre explique le mécanisme complexe de la prise de décision commerciale et présente la fonction Revenue Management qui allie différents aspects du marketing management (segmentation, pricing, distribution…) à d'autres problématiques (optimisation du chiffre d'affaires, gestion des capacités et des volumes de vente, analyse du budget…). Résolument concret, l'ouvrage offre une vision complète et opérationnelle de la fonction Revenue Management. Le Revenue Management s'applique aujourd'hui à toutes les activités de services (espaces publicitaires, hôtellerie, transports, location de voiture ou de bureau, salles de spectacle…). Entièrement revue et mise à jour, cette 2e édition s'enrichit de cas d'entreprise et avis d'expert.

"International cartels are powerful organizations that impact our everyday lives, although they are little known. This book presents fifteen historical case studies of international cartels that include agricultural and mineral commodities, the machinery industry, telephone equipment, whiskey and cement. They reveal that international cartels manipulated prices and shared markets over many decades, but that their real impact was far wider. The global convergence towards criminalizing serious cartel conduct has seen a revival in historical research on cartels and competition policy. The regulation of anti-competitive behaviour has changed over time. To understand why US, European and other modern economies altered their policies through the 20th century, it is critical to understand when, how and why governments have interacted with, and been influenced by, business organizations such as cartels. This volume draws together researchers from different nations to examine the impact of international cartels on the experience of individual countries; those nations' interactions with one or more international cartels; and ultimately with the individual nation's interactions with the wider international community. This book will be of interest to researchers, academics and advanced students in the fields of business and economic history, political economy, and government policy and those interested in cartels and their impact on the wider economy"--
